The Rise of Minimalist Design in Modern Restaurants
In recent years, minimalist design has become a dominant trend in the global hospitality industry. Restaurants are moving away from decorative and complex tableware styles and instead choosing simple, clean, and functional flatware designs.
This shift is not only aesthetic but also strategic, helping restaurants build stronger and more consistent brand identities.
Why Minimalist Flatware Matters for Branding
1. Enhances Brand Identity
Minimalist flatware allows restaurants to highlight their food presentation rather than distracting decorative elements. Clean designs support a stronger focus on the culinary experience, which reinforces brand positioning.
2. Creates a Premium Dining Experience
Simple and well-balanced flatware designs often feel more refined and high-end. This helps restaurants create a perception of quality, even before the food is served.
3. Matches Modern Interior Design Trends
Many contemporary restaurants use:
- Neutral color palettes
- Open space layouts
- Natural materials like wood and stone
Minimalist flatware complements these design elements perfectly.
4. Improves Customer Visual Consistency
Consistency is key in branding. Minimalist flatware ensures that every table setting looks uniform and visually aligned, improving the overall dining atmosphere.

Why Restaurants Prefer Simplicity Over Decoration
Highly decorative flatware can:
- Clash with food presentation
- Look outdated in modern interiors
- Reduce visual focus on dishes
Minimalist design solves these problems by creating a neutral and elegant foundation for dining.
Commercial Advantages for Restaurants
Minimalist flatware also provides operational benefits:
- Easier to match across different collections
- Suitable for multiple restaurant concepts
- More cost-effective for bulk procurement
- Longer design lifecycle (less trend-dependent)
